Year: 1986
Runtime: 103 mins
Language: French
Director: Léa Pool
After her father's death, Anne, a talented but emotionally unstable painter and sculptor, returns from Switzerland to her hometown in Quebec. She sets up a studio and immerses herself in her art, becoming increasingly consumed by creation, which drives a wedge between her and her Swiss lover, highlighting her struggle with grief and isolation.
